Job Summary

Position is located on site in Webster, MA (Hybrid Schedule)

Provides oversight and direction to ensure that VMO programs align and support the company’s goals and strategic direction. Serving as the liaison with the Corporate Procurement Team, facilitates executive meetings with vendors and collaborates with Finance to insure appropriate budgeting and spending. Maintains supplier relationship management policies and procedures in compliance with corporate policy and within the Principles and Standards of the supply management profession. Responsible for overall strategy to improve processes, relationships, and business structure to improve efficiency and quality of operations.
